LAPO MfB appoints Ehigiamusoe as Board chair

LAPO Microfinance Bank has appointed Dr. Godwin Ehigiamusoe as the new Chairman of its Board of Directors, succeeding Mrs. Osaretin Demuren.

The bank praised Demuren for her leadership, particularly in strengthening LAPO’s position in Nigeria’s microfinance sector.

Dr. Ehigiamusoe, a seasoned microfinance expert, brings over three decades of experience in financial inclusion and economic development. He founded the Lift Above Poverty Organization (LAPO) in the late 1980s as a response to poverty exacerbated by Nigeria’s Structural Adjustment Programme. Under his leadership, LAPO has expanded into microfinance, healthcare, insurance, micro-leasing, technology, and agriculture.

A chartered microfinance banker and Fellow of the Chartered Institute of Bankers of Nigeria, Dr. Ehigiamusoe holds a doctorate in policy and development studies with a focus on financial inclusion.

Expressing his commitment to advancing LAPO’s mission, he described his appointment as an opportunity to build on the institution’s achievements and further drive financial inclusion across the country.
